Hospital lottery
TWO winners shared the £1,740 jackpot prize in the weekly lottery run by the League of Friends of Warrington Hospital – each receiving £870. Winning numbers were 4, 6, 7 and 13. A £25 consolation prize was also paid out.

Parking objection
WARRINGTON’S traffic committee has received one objection to a proposal to ban parking in Dewhurst Road, Birchwood since a £1-a-day charge was introduced on the car park at the nearby shopping centre. The objector argued that the correct solution would be to provide proper parking facility at Birchwood Station.

Farmer’s Market
CHARITY group The Walton Lea Project are holding a farmer’s market in the Heritage Yard, Walton Gardens, tomorrow (Sunday). Among the stalls will be a micro-brewery.

Wind power
TESCO are seeking planning consent for a wind turbine on the car park at the superstore in Winwick Road. The 10.6m high installation would help provide electricity for the store.

More light
MEMBERS of Grappenhall and Thelwall Parish Council are pressing for improved street lighting in Sharon Park Close, Grappenhall.
